#1ce80e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ce80e is composed of 11% red, 91%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 94%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 116.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 48.2%. #1ce80e color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ff1c with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#1ce80e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ce80e has RGB values of R:28, G:232,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1894414.

Shades and Tints of #1ce80e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a01 is the darkest color, while #f7f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ce80e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#778076 is the less saturated color, while #14f105 is the most saturated one.
